您好,登錄后才能下訂單哦!
本篇內容介紹了“linux管理員賬號是哪個”的有關知識,在實際案例的操作過程中,不少人都會遇到這樣的困境,接下來就讓小編帶領大家學習一下如何處理這些情況吧!希望大家仔細閱讀,能夠學有所成!
linux默認的管理員賬號是root;linux系統將管理賬號分為管理用戶賬號和管理組賬號,作用本質一樣,都是基于用戶身份來控制對資源的訪問,root用戶就是linux系統中默認的超級用戶賬號,對主機擁有最高的權限。
本教程操作環境:linux7.3系統、Dell G3電腦。
Linux 默認的系統管理員賬號是root
Linux系統將管理賬號分為管理用戶賬號跟管理組賬號,作用本質一樣,都是基于用戶身份來控制對資源的訪問,區別在于是單個用戶還是多個用戶組成的群組。今天小編就先來詳細介紹下,Linux系統的管理用戶賬號。
在 Linux系統中,根據系統管理的需要將用戶賬號分為不同的類型,同時也有不同的權限與不同的功能,主要分為超級用戶、普通用戶和程序用戶。
1)超級用戶:root用戶是 Linux系統中默認的超級用戶賬號,對主機擁有最高的權限,類似于 Windows系統中的 Administrator用戶。只有當進行系統管理、維護任務時,才建議使用root用戶登錄系統,日常事務處理建議只使用普通用戶賬號。
2)普通用戶:普通用戶賬號需要由root用戶或其他管理員用戶創建,擁有的權限受到一定限制,一般只在用戶自己的宿主目錄中擁有完整權限。
3)程序用戶:在安裝 Linux系統及部分應用程序時,會添加一些特定的低權限用戶賬號,這些用戶一般不允許登錄到系統,而僅用于維持系統或某個程序的正常運行,如bin、 daemon、ftp、mail等。
擴展知識
UID號
Linux系統中的每一個用戶賬號都有一個數字形式的身份標記,稱為UID,是ser IDentity用戶標識號,對于系統核心來說,UID作為區分用戶的基本依據,原則上每個用戶的UID號應該是唯一的。root用戶賬號的UID號為固定值0,而程序用戶賬號的UID號默認為1~999,1000~60000的UID號默認分配給普通用戶使用。
用戶賬號文件
1)/etc/passwd用于保存用戶名稱、宿主目錄、登錄Shell等基本信息。
passwd文件中的配置行格式如下:
root : x : 0 : 0 : root: /root : /bin/bash
拆解為
root :用戶賬號,
X:密碼占位符,
0:用戶賬號ID,
0:組賬號IP,
root:用戶說明,
/root:宿主目錄,
/bin/bash:登錄Shell。
2)/etc/shadow用于保存用戶的密碼、賬號有效期等信息。下面詳解shadow文件中的配置各字段含義。
1 字段:用戶賬號名稱。
2 字段:使用 SHA-512,哈希算法中的一種加密的密碼字串信息,當為“或”、“!!”時表示此用戶不能登錄到系統。若該字段內容為空,則該用戶無須密碼即可登錄系統。
3 字段:上次修改密碼的時間,表示從 1970 年 01 月 01起始日算起到最近一次修改密碼時間隔的天數。
4 字段:密碼的最短有效天數,自本次修改密碼后,必須至少經過該天數才能再 次修改密碼。默認值為 0,表示不進行限制。
5 字段:密碼的最長有效天數,自本次修改密碼后,經過該天數以后必須再次修 改密碼。默認值為 99999,表示不進行限制。
6 字段:提前多少天警告用戶密碼將過期,默認值為 7。
7 字段:在密碼過期之后多少天內禁用此用戶。
8 字段:賬號失效時間,此字段指定了用戶作廢的天數,默認值為空,表示賬號永久可用。
9 字段:保留字段,目前沒有特定用途。
“linux管理員賬號是哪個”的內容就介紹到這里了,感謝大家的閱讀。如果想了解更多行業相關的知識可以關注億速云網站,小編將為大家輸出更多高質量的實用文章!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。